ArmInfo. Russia advocates that all humanitarian issues related to the Karabakh conflict be resolved as quickly as possible and without preconditions. Russian Foreign Minister Sergei Lavrov said this in Baku on May 11, answering a question about peace maps.
"This also applies to mines that kill civilians. I mean issues related to the transfer of the bodies of the dead, and clarification of the fate of the missing, and the return of prisoners of war, and the settlement of problems associated with the material remnants of the war, in this case, mines. We discussed this issue a few days ago in Yerevan. It seemed to me that the Armenian leadership has an understanding of the need to solve this problem, "the minister said, adding that the first preliminary steps in this direction were made, and the leadership of Azerbaijan was informed about this.
At the same time, Lavrov noted that Moscow expects that this process will be significantly accelerated and the problem will be completely resolved.
It should be noted that the Azerbaijani authorities deliberately delay the process of returning Armenian prisoners of war and civilians, and for the 7th month, in violation of the 8th clause of the trilateral statement, they continue to detain several hundred Armenians.
